College of the Mainland is in Texas City, TX.

During the most recent reporting year, 6 drama & theater arts graduations were recorded at College of the Mainland.

Online Class Availability at College of the Mainland

Distance learning is available at College of the Mainland. Of 5,127 students, 809 (16%) were enrolled entirely in distance education and 1,444 (28%) took at least some classes online.
